| THE
BENCHMARK AND THE PRETENDER-TO-ITS-THRONE Amongst the sports cars which have stood out in the last decade, the evocative 550bhp BMW V12 engined McLaren F1 remains the standout machine for a host of reasons. Even though it is now no longer in production, McLaren affecting a cut-off after only 300 units were built, thanks to their growing links with Mercedes-Benz, this three-seater sports car penned by the brilliant Gordon Murray and styled by the equally illustrious Peter Stevens has written its name in the history books in words of gold.
McLaren
intended to build this car not to take on the likes of Ferrari F40 or
F50 or even the others like the Lamborghini and the Honda NSX models but
kick off a whole new direction for the sports car to head into. The central
driving position and the two seats on either side of the driver was as
radical a concept as was the thought that this car could have a 200mph/320kmph
'cruising speed' and a top speed anywhere in excess of 250mph/400kmph.
If the McLaren F1's record seems to remain in tact, the Volkswagen Group is getting ready to unleash a stormer of a car in the stunning new Bugatti Veyron, a machine this magazine has referred to over the past few months. VW under Ferdinand Peich is getting into sports cars with a vengeance and even though it has bought Lamborghini, made the VW W12, put Audi and Bentley into sports car racing, it is the Bugatti Veyron with its 1000bhp and 1000Nm on tap which can usurp, nay obliterate the McLaren F1's awesome performance records. We just can't wait to see it in production. |
